Purdue West Lafayette spring commencement to be shown live on TV, webcast

April 28, 2010

WEST LAFAYETTE, Ind. — The spring commencement ceremonies at Purdue University's West Lafayette campus will be broadcast live for television and Internet audiences.

The ceremonies will take place at the Elliott Hall of Music on May 14, 15 and 16.

The colleges of Agriculture; Consumer and Family Sciences; and Pharmacy, Nursing and Health Sciences will have their commencement at 8 p.m. Friday, May 14. The colleges of Education, and Engineering, and the School of Veterinary Medicine will have their ceremony at 9:30 a.m. Saturday, May 15. The Krannert School of Management and College of Technology commencement will take place at 2:30 p.m. the same day. The colleges of Science and Liberal Arts will have their ceremony at 9:30 a.m. Sunday, May 16.

The events will be aired live on Comcast Channel 5 and Boiler TV Channel 13. All speeches will be captioned for the hearing impaired. The ceremonies also will be shown live via webcast at mms://video.dis.purdue.edu/graduation

The link will not become active until 48 hours before the ceremony.

To watch online, viewers must have Windows Media Player installed on their computers. It can be downloaded free at https://www.Microsoft.com/windows/windowsmedia/download/

Commencement videos will be available at $30 per DVD. Order forms can be obtained at the Loeb Playhouse Box Office, online at https://www.purdue.edu/registrar/pdf/DVD_Form.pdf or by calling 765-494-3933. Forms may be submitted both before and after the ceremony within two weeks of the event.
